搭建代理服务器:正向代理、反向代理、透明代理与透明模式
2024.01.05 16:10浏览量:18简介:本文将介绍正向代理、反向代理、透明代理和透明模式的概念,并详细说明如何使用Squid在Windows XP上搭建代理服务器。
正向代理指的是位于客户端和目标服务器之间的服务器,它充当了客户端的代理,帮助客户端向目标服务器发出请求。正向代理需要客户端在浏览器中指定代理服务器的地址和端口。
反向代理则是指以代理服务器来接受Internet上的连接请求,然后将请求转发给内部网络上的服务器,并将从服务器上得到的结果返回给Internet上请求连接的客户端。此时,代理服务器对外表现为一个服务器。
透明代理则是适用于企业的网关主机(共享接入Internet)中,客户机不需要指定代理服务器地址、端口等信息,代理服务器需要设置防火墙策略将客户机的Web访问数据转交给代理服务程序处理。
Squid是一个开源的、高性能的HTTP缓存服务器,可以作为反向代理服务器使用。在Windows XP上搭建Squid代理服务器需要以下步骤:
- 下载并安装Squid。可以从Squid官方网站下载Squid的Windows版本,并按照提示进行安装。
- 配置Squid。打开Squid的配置文件squid.conf,根据需要进行代理服务器的配置,如监听地址、端口、代理模式等。
- 启动Squid。在命令行中输入squid命令启动Squid服务。
- 测试代理服务器。可以在客户端浏览器中设置代理服务器地址和端口,测试是否能够通过Squid代理服务器访问互联网。
需要注意的是,搭建代理服务器需要一定的网络知识和技术,需要谨慎操作,以免对网络造成影响。同时,也需要注意代理服务器的安全问题,如设置防火墙、限制访问权限等措施来保护代理服务器的安全。
发表评论
登录后可评论,请前往 登录 或 注册